# rsync deployments
2019-02-09 14:17:45 +01:00
2022-07-30 10:19:44 +02:00
This GitHub Action (amd64) deploys files in `GITHUB_WORKSPACE` to a remote folder via rsync over ssh.
2019-02-09 14:17:45 +01:00
2019-12-27 16:29:01 +01:00
Use this action in a CD workflow which leaves deployable code in `GITHUB_WORKSPACE`.
2024-03-06 14:33:58 +01:00
The base-image [drinternet/rsync](https://github.com/JoshPiper/rsync-docker/) of this action is very small and is based on Alpine 3.19.1 (no cache) which results in fast deployments.

## Inputs
2019-02-09 14:17:45 +01:00
2019-12-04 18:41:36 +01:00
- `switches`* - The first is for any initial/required rsync flags, eg: `-avzr --delete`
2019-02-09 14:17:45 +01:00
2019-12-04 19:02:32 +01:00
- `rsh` - Remote shell commands
2019-11-12 23:39:54 +01:00
- `legacy_allow_rsa_hostkeys` - Enables support for legacy RSA host keys on OpenSSH 8.8+. ("true" / "false")
2022-07-30 10:19:44 +02:00
- `path` - The source path. Defaults to GITHUB_WORKSPACE and is relative to it
2019-02-09 14:17:45 +01:00
2019-12-04 18:35:52 +01:00
- `remote_path`* - The deployment target path
2019-02-09 14:17:45 +01:00
- `remote_host`* - The remote host
2019-02-09 14:17:45 +01:00
2019-12-04 18:58:49 +01:00
- `remote_port` - The remote port. Defaults to 22
- `remote_user`* - The remote user
2019-11-12 23:39:54 +01:00
- `remote_key`* - The remote ssh key
- `remote_key_pass` - The remote ssh key passphrase (if any)
2019-12-04 18:37:11 +01:00
``* = Required``
## Required secret(s)
This action needs secret variables for the ssh private key of your key pair. The public key part should be added to the authorized_keys file on the server that receives the deployment. The secret variable should be set in the Github secrets section of your org/repo and then referenced as the `remote_key` input.
> Always use secrets when dealing with sensitive inputs!
For simplicity, we are using `DEPLOY_*` as the secret variables throughout the examples.

#### Legacy RSA Hostkeys support for OpenSSH Servers >= 8.8+
If your remote OpenSSH Server still uses RSA hostkeys, then you have to
manually enable legacy support for this by using ``legacy_allow_rsa_hostkeys: "true"``.
```
jobs:
deploy:
runs-on: ubuntu-latest
steps:
- uses: actions/checkout@v3
- name: rsync deployments
2024-03-30 10:49:50 +01:00
uses: burnett01/rsync-deployments@7.0.1
with:
switches: -avzr --delete
legacy_allow_rsa_hostkeys: "true"
path: src/
remote_path: ${{ secrets.DEPLOY_PATH }}
remote_host: ${{ secrets.DEPLOY_HOST }}
remote_port: ${{ secrets.DEPLOY_PORT }}
remote_user: ${{ secrets.DEPLOY_USER }}
remote_key: ${{ secrets.DEPLOY_KEY }}
```
See [#49](https://github.com/Burnett01/rsync-deployments/issues/49) and [#24](https://github.com/Burnett01/rsync-deployments/issues/24) for more information.
